St. Louis + Louisville This Weekend

This weekend I’m hitching a ride on a jetliner and bringing my pack of tunes to a couple of fun mid-west venues. Friday night I will find myself in St. Louis and then on Saturday I’ll be skipping over to Louisville for a golden pair of rollicking Q-Burns Abstract Message DJ gigs. I’ve got loads of new music in tow and a few extra tricks up my sleeve so if you happen to be in the area then I hope you’ll join me. Here are the scintillating details:

Friday, December 3 – St. Louis, MO at Europe Nightclub

Blistering good vibes are expected as I roll into one of my favorite cities. The action starts at 9:30 PM with opening DJs Pattern Pusher + Slant-E, Narcosis, and Trevor Matthews. It’s 18 and up but if you’re over 21 then you can enjoy the dangerously free Stolli vodka until 11 PM. It’s a $10 cover, and Europe Nightclub is located at 710 North 15th Street. Saturday, December 4 – Louisville, KY at Audyssey Nightclub

I’m a little late for what was once my annual Thanksgiving weekend Kentucky visit, but you knew I wouldn’t let you down totally. Louisville is always a good time and I’m positive this will be no exception. The club opens the doors at 10 PM and plan to keep things going until the break-a-dawn, just like those good old days. Nate FX, DJ Drek, and Cid Vicious are also spinning tunes and it’s 18 and up with a $10 cover. Audyssey Nightclub is located at 2420 South 4th Street in Louisville. Invisible Airwaves Radio Show – November Edition

The cool wind of November rolls around revealing another episode of my monthly Invisible Airwaves radio show. I’m pleased to present yet another two hour mix featuring quite a bit of new discoveries as well as a couple classic gems thrown in. Things are a bit housier than the last time around, but there’s still plenty of disco bits to keep this a slinky and funky affair. Here’s the track list:

1. Havana Candy – Rimentos Sical – Havana Candy
2. Oblong – Playing On My Mind (Maelstrom Vocal Mix) – Exceptional Records
3. Space Ranger – Crystal Coffee – Grande Buffo Recordings
4. Joey Negro presents Kola Kube – Why? (Hot Toddy Special Dub) – Surround Sounds
5. Johnny Paguro – Soda – Pizzico Nobel
6. Incarnations – Make You Mine (Barck + Prommer Remix) – Lovemonk Records
7. Viana & Miguel Garji – The Black Mountain (Soul Minority Mix) – Seamless Recordings
8. Audio Soul Project – Never Go Away – Fresh Meat Records
9. Asad Rizvi – Fair Dinkum – Onethirty Recordings
10. Iz & Diz – Love Vibe (Brett Johnson’s “Better Days” Remix) – Aesoteric Records
11. Bangana – Follow The Snake – Heya Hifi
12. Dave Barker – Moving – Full Flavor Music
13. Inland Knights – After Me – Drop Music
14. Hawke – Everything Is Happening At The Same Time (Atnarko Remix) – Eighth Dimension
15. Hardway Bros – The Flesh (Mugwump Remix) – Astro Lab Recordings
16. Sleazy McQueen feat. Anne Montone – Anna Due (Social Disco Club Remix) – Whiskey Disco
17. In Deep We Trust – Hopscotch (Rayko Remix) – In Deep Records
18. Ichisan & Nakova – Space 1999 – Nang Records
19. Dennis Jr. – Multefunk (Dub) – Akustikk Recordings

Invisible Airwaves Radio Show – October Edition

Invisible Airwaves returns for another action-packed mix by yours truly filled with loads of top tunes from the past month as well as a few surprises. The tempo is a bit more relaxed this time around, but chuggy tracks abound making for what I think is a wild and eclectic dance floor selection. Check out the included cuts below:

1. Crimea X – 10pm – Hell Yeah
2. Carl Craig – Home Enterambient (Combo ReEdit) – Unreleased Re-Edit
3. Anthony Mansfield & Tal M. Klein – Raindance – Hector Works
4. Enzo Ponzio – A New Way (Golden Bug Remix) – Solardisco
5. Hannulelauri – Super Monkey – Relish
6. Jet Project – Cuba Walking (Bubba’s Rolled On A Virgin’s Thigh Mix) – Extended Play
7. Q-Burns Abstract Message feat. Lisa Shaw – Innocent (Cole Medina’s Nue Boogie Mix – Eighth Dimension
8. The Groovers – Chicken Noodles (Groovenauts Remix) – Pack Up And Dance
9. Toomy Disco – A Girl Called Zara – Sosound
10. Justin Harris – Shadows (Popular Peoples Front Into The Light Rework) – Eclectic Avenue Records
11. Rotciv – So – Mister Mistery
12. Eddie C – Dub Up The Edit – Home Taping Is Killing Music
13. Die Fantastischen Vier – Geboren (C-Rock Dub) – Unreleased Re-Edit
14. Jimmy Edgar – Hot, Raw, Sex – !K7
15. Bonar Bradberry – Turning Loose (Ron Basejam Remix) – Under The Shade
16. Woop – In The Jungle – BaxxBeatMusic
17. David August – Rebound Bro – Diynamic
18. Funky Transport – Set Me Up – Disport Records
19. P-rez feat. J.A.M.O.N. – On The 4 (Courtney Nielsen Remix) – Blunted Funk
20. Damon Vallero – Make Believe (Game Of Faith) – Downstream Records
21. DJ Mourad – I Always Knew – Lace Recordings
22. Four Tet – Angel Echoes (Jon Hopkins Remix) – Domino

Invisible Airwaves Radio Show – September Edition

September’s Invisible Airwaves radio show is chock full of cool tracks, transmitting the tunes that have grabbed my attention in the last thirty days. It’s a two hour mix in two parts … the first is a warm and spacey deep house affair and then the tempo gets dropped as we descend into some chunky Balearic goodness. Here’s the track list for this month’s selection:

1. Sebastian Arevalo – Plo – DeepClass Records
2. Pablo Fierro – Indigo Childrens (Hector Couto Beautiful Remix) – Gramma Rec.
3. Edmund – Forbidden Fruit – Low Flow White
4. Louie Austen – Now Or Never (Phonique Remix) – LA Music
5. Satta – Cold Flamenco (Biolectric Remix) – Xeriscape Records
6. Deepak Sharma & Dieter Krause – The Great Lawn (Alland Byallo Remix) – Hidden Recordings
7. Miguel Garji & Dj Viana – The Lake – DeepClass Records
8. Shenoda – Departed (Wasted Chicago Youth Remix) – Fresh Meat
9. Murray Richardson – Generations – Baker Street Recordings
10. Shonky – KorgM1 – Spectral Sound
11. Alex V – Luna – Deepology Digital
12. The Dead Rose Music Company – Am I Still The One (Rob Mello’s No Ears Mix) – Eclectic Avenue Records
13. Fernando – Spiral (Fernando Rework) – Solardisco
14. Marbeya Sound – No Anchor (Altair Nouveau Remix) – Solardisco
15. Havana Candy – Seventies Jibs – HCR
16. Dennis Jr – Get Me All The Way – Akustikk Recordings
17. Zoe’s Raygun – Meet Me At The Horizon (Organic Soul Mix) – Community Recordings
18. Flowers and Sea Creatures – At Night (Dub) – Buzzin Fly
19. Craig Bratley – Birdshell (6th Borough Project Shell Toe Mix) – Instruments Of Rapture
20. Röyksopp – The Alcoholic – Wall Of Sound
